Partilhar via


Melhorar rascunhos de e-mail com ligações de ficheiro da sua aplicação (pré-visualização)

Importante

[Este artigo é uma documentação de pré-lançamento e está sujeito a alterações.]

Quando usa a aplicação Sales para redigir um email, ela considera a intenção do email e utiliza informações de CRM do Salesforce ou Dynamics 365 para criar o rascunho. Pode expandir a capacidade de redação de emails que a aplicação Sales oferece com ficheiros recomendados da sua própria aplicação.

Nota

Esta funcionalidade é suportada apenas para rascunhos de email criados através da aplicação Sales no Outlook.

Descrição da API

Tem de adicionar a seguinte descrição da API à ação. Desta forma, a aplicação Sales pode identificar a API correta que deve ser invocada para enriquecer a capacidade.

Esta ação obtém ficheiros relevantes para a conversação de e-mail, que serão mostrados em rascunhos de e-mail C4S no Outlook. A ação aprimora as capacidades existentes do Copilot para vendas.

Operação API

Esta API usa o tipo de operação: POST

Payload de entrada

Este payload vai como o corpo do pedido da API.

Nome Tipo de Dados Obrigatório Detalhes Descrição a adicionar na ação
resourceData Objeto Sim Os dados do recurso a usar para obter o conteúdo sugerido. Para a estrutura de dados, aceda ao Modelo de dados de e-mail de extensibilidade. Esta entrada identifica o conteúdo do e-mail, que é uma coleção de tópico de e-mail, assunto e outros detalhes.
tipoDeRecurso Cadeia (de carateres) Sim O tipo de recurso para o qual se obtêm sugestões de conteúdo. Por exemplo, 'email-thread' ou 'teams-chat'. Esta entrada identifica o tipo de recurso partilhado para obter ligações de ficheiros sugeridos que, neste caso, é 'email-thread'.
recordType Cadeia (de carateres) Não O tipo de registo do CRM, como conta ou oportunidade. Esta entrada identifica o tipo de registo no CRM, que está relacionada com o tópico de e-mail.
recordId Cadeia (de carateres) Não O identificador exclusivo do registo de CRM a usar para conteúdos sugeridos. Esta entrada fornece o identificador exclusivo do registo de CRM que está relacionado com o tópico de e-mail.
crmType Cadeia (de carateres) Não O tipo de sistema de CRM, se ligado. Os valores válidos são Salesforce e Dynamics 365. Esta entrada indica o tipo de CRM em que existe o registo relacionado com o tópico de e-mail.
crmOrgUrl Cadeia (de carateres) Não O URL da organização de CRM. Esta entrada indica o URL do ambiente de CRM em que existe o registo relacionado com o tópico de e-mail.
inputPrompt Cadeia (de carateres) Não O pedido sugerido usado atualmente dado pelo utilizador para gerar o rascunho de e-mail. Por exemplo, "Responder a uma preocupação" ou "Fazer uma proposta". Esta entrada indica o pedido fornecido pelo utilizador durante a elaboração de um rascunho de e-mail.
principal Número inteiro Não O número de itens a obter. Esta entrada indica o número de ligações de ficheiro a obter.
ignorar Número inteiro Não O número de itens a ignorar. Esta entrada indica o número de itens a ignorar ao obter ligações de ficheiros sugeridos.

Modelo de dados de e-mail de extensibilidade

Propriedade Tipo Detalhes Descrição a adicionar na ação
plaintextBody Cadeia (de carateres) O corpo completo do e-mail inclui todas as mensagens anteriores do tópico de e-mail nele contido. Esta entrada fornece todo o conteúdo do tópico de e-mail em formato de texto.
fullHtmlBody Cadeia (de carateres) A versão HTML completa do corpo do e-mail que inclui todas as mensagens anteriores do tópico de e-mail nele contido. Esta entrada fornece todo o conteúdo do tópico de e-mail em formato HTML.
requerente Cadeia (de carateres) Assunto do e-mail. Esta entrada fornece o assunto do e-mail.
de Cadeia (de carateres) Endereço de e-mail do remetente. Esta entrada fornece o endereço de e-mail do remetente.
para Cadeia (de carateres)[] Endereços de e-mail do destinatário. Esta entrada fornece o endereço de e-mail do destinatário.
cc Cadeia (de carateres)[] Os endereços de e-mail dos destinatários adicionados ao campo Cc do e-mail. Esta entrada fornece todos os endereços de e-mail do destinatário que estão incluídos no campo Cc do e-mail.
bcc Cadeia (de carateres)[] Os endereços de e-mail dos destinatários adicionados ao campo Bcc do e-mail. Esta entrada fornece todos os endereços de e-mail do destinatário que são adicionado ao campo Bcc do e-mail.
sentDateTime DateTimeOffset A data e a hora do e-mail no formato UTC, juntamente com a propriedade Offset. Para obter mais informações, aceda a Estrutura de DateTimeOffset (Sistema) Esta entrada fornece o carimbo de data/hora do e-mail.
ID da mensagem Cadeia (de carateres) O ID de mensagem do Graph do e-mail. Esta entrada fornece o ID da mensagem do e-mail.
conversationId Cadeia (de carateres) O ID de conversação do Graph do tópico do e-mail. Esta entrada fornece o ID da conversação do tópico do e-mail.

Parâmetros de saída

Propriedade Tipo de Dados Obrigatório Detalhes
valor Matriz Sim Uma lista de ligações de ficheiro (objetos) definidos conforme descrito na resposta Esquema para sugestões de conteúdo de ficheiro ou ligação.
hasMoreResults booleano Não Um valor que indica se estão disponíveis mais resultados.
Nome Formato do tipo de dados Obrigatório Detalhes Descrição a adicionar na ação
TipoDeConteúdo cadeia (de caracteres) Sim O tipo de conteúdo a apresentar. Para mais informações, aceda a Valores predefinidos para contentType Esta saída indica o tipo de conteúdo incluído no rascunho do e-mail.
conteúdo cadeia (de caracteres) Sim Conteúdo real incluído. Pode ser uma página Web ou um URL do ficheiro. Esta saída indica o conteúdo real que está incluído no rascunho do e-mail. Pode ser uma página Web ou um URL.
contentTitle cadeia (de caracteres) Sim Título do conteúdo sugerido mostrado ao utilizador. Esta saída indica o título do conteúdo.
conteúdoDescrição cadeia (de caracteres) Sim Descrição do conteúdo sugerido mostrado ao utilizador. Esta saída indica o texto a incluir ao descrever os ficheiros.
contentIconUrl cadeia (de caracteres) Não Ícone do conteúdo sugerido mostrado ao utilizador. Se não for fornecido, é utilizado um ícone genérico. Esta saída indica o ícone a incluir para o conteúdo.
additionalProperties Objeto Não Um conjunto de pares nome-valor que indica as propriedades adicionais da ligação de ficheiro relacionada que a ação devolve. Esta saída indica propriedades adicionais como pares nome-valor de cada ligação relacionada devolvida pela ação.

Valores predefinidos para contentType

Valor de cadeia Tipo de conteúdo
arquivo de conteúdo Ficheiro Externo (Genérico)
content-web Página web externa
content-doc Documento do Microsoft Word
content-pdf Documento PDF da Microsoft
conteúdo-pptx Apresentação do Microsoft PowerPoint
content-xlsx Folha de cálculo do Microsoft Excel

Exemplo

{
  "value": [
    {
      "contentType": 0,
      "content": "https://www.bing.com",
      "contentTitle": "Purchase Contract",
      "contentDescription": "Purchase Contract Description",
      "contentIconUrl": null,
      "additionalProperties": {
        "Recipients": "Logan Edwards",
        "Sender Name": "Kenny Smith"
      }
    },
    {
      "contentType": 3,
      "content": "https://www.microsoft.com",
      "contentTitle": "Strategy Planning",
      "contentDescription": "Strategy Planning Description",
      "contentIconUrl": null,
      "additionalProperties": {
        "Recipients": "Gabriela Edwards",
        "Sender Name": "Maria Smith"
      }
    },
    {
      "contentType": 1,
      "content": "https://www.bing.com",
      "contentTitle": "Contoso Website",
      "contentDescription": "Contoso Website Description",
      "contentIconUrl": null,
      "additionalProperties": {
        "Total Views": "100",
        "Domain": "Contoso.com"
      }
    }
  ],
  "hasMoreResults": false
}

O exemplo na imagem seguinte mostra um exemplo de como a saída da API é mapeada para o rascunho de e-mail.

Captura de ecrã a mostrar ligações de ficheiro de aplicações de parceiros no rascunho de e-mail.

Legenda:

  1. Ligações de ficheiro de aplicações parceiras.

Veja também

Resumir um tópico de e-mail utilizando informações de vendas com o Copilot no Outlook
Enriquecer resumos do e-mail com informações da sua aplicação
Enriqueça insights de oportunidades com dados de seu aplicativo
Melhorar detalhes do registo CRM com informações da sua aplicação
Melhorar os resumos do registo CRM com informações da sua aplicação
Amplie as Vendas no Microsoft 365 Copilot com aplicações parceiras
Construir extensões para Vendas no Microsoft 365 Copilot